Sundance 2020

 

Sundance Relies on Community Support

CAMP Rehoboth Seeks Hosts, Supporters, and Sponsors for Virtual Event

For more than 30 years, the annual Labor Day weekend Sundance event has been both a major source of funding for CAMP Rehoboth and a beloved occasion that celebrates community, brings old and new friends together, and recognizes Rehoboth as a place with room for all. 

This year, CAMP Rehoboth is turning Sundance into a week-long, virtual United in Love celebration, fundraiser, and community-building experience that starts August 29 at 6 p.m. and ends on September 5. More than ever, CAMP Rehoboth is counting on members of the community to support the event by pledging as a host, supporter, or sponsor.

“We’re meeting the current challenges in creative ways,” says David Mariner, CAMP Rehoboth’s Executive Director. “From youth circles and virtual concerts to chair yoga and virtual book discussions, we are providing innovative programs for the physical and mental health of the community. Now we need that community to help us continue to offer these and many other valuable services.” 

Murray Archibald, Sundance Chair and CAMP Rehoboth’s co-founder, adds, “We have always relied on a strong base of supporters and we need them this year more than ever. Their passion, kindness, and love inspire us and drive everything we do.” 

Members of the community can support CAMP Rehoboth in several ways. By pledging as a host ($100 for individual or business) the donor will be listed on the event poster and receive a Sundance 2020 T-shirt. At the supporter level ($500, $750) the donor receives three T-shirts and a listing on the website as well as the poster. A gold level that offers special recognition is available for both host and supporter donors. Sponsors ($1000+, $2,500+, $5,000+) are additionally listed on advertising, publicity, and event banners, and receive other recognition throughout the event and online.
